Skip to content

Sales Director – Agency – Omg
Company | Netflix |
---|
Location | New York, NY, USA |
---|
Salary | $380000 – $900000 |
---|
Type | Full-Time |
---|
Degrees | |
---|
Experience Level | Expert or higher |
---|
Requirements
- 15+ years of experience in audience/ data driven advertising sales spanning across direct and programmatic, and at least 5+ years of managing people leaders of high-performing sales teams, with a proven track record of delivering revenue growth.
- Deep understanding of the advertising ecosystem in the US market and an established network of relationships with advertisers and agencies
- Experience in developing Brand + Performance advertising solutions for agencies and brands with a track record of delivery and revenue growth.
- Strong understanding of the video marketplace dynamics—and how these ecosystems are rapidly converging, including competitive streaming, broadcasters and programmatic partners
- Strong expertise in the programmatic ecosystem, including experience working with DSPs, SSPs, and advanced video buying strategies.
- Success in going to market with data-driven media insight and planning solutions through both first party solutions and direct integration work with agencies.
- Depth of experience and unlocking revenue opportunity across strategic areas of the agency ecosystem across Planning, Analytics, Investment and Programmatic & Performance teams.
- Strong analytical (strategic and creative) capabilities and judgment.
- Excellent communication and presentation skills.
- Strong leadership skills with the ability to motivate and inspire teams and experience of building sales teams.
- Experience in leading teams of Sales Managers + Individual Contributors.
- Ability to work effectively and collaboratively cross‐functionally.
- A deep curiosity about our global business and an ability to quickly build global IQ and an understanding of regional and cultural nuances
- A natural problem-solver who can work through challenges and navigate comfortably in ambiguity.
Responsibilities
- Develop and execute the advertising sales strategy to deliver revenue targets and exceed client expectations, across both direct and programmatic channels
- Build and maintain strong relationships with key advertisers, agencies, and media stakeholders across Omnicom to secure partnerships and drive revenue growth.
- Identify and pursue new revenue opportunities with existing and new clients.
- Collaborate with cross-functional teams to ensure the successful delivery of advertising campaigns.
- Leverage Netflix’s unique audience insights and premium content offerings to drive revenue growth.
- Provide strategic guidance and leadership to a team of Sales Managers + Individual Contributors.
- Monitor market trends, competitor activity and identify opportunities for innovation.
Preferred Qualifications
- A passion for entertainment and a desire to work in a fast-paced, innovative environment.